移动时代的到来,给我们的生活带来了翻天覆地的变化。无论是通勤上班,还是闲暇娱乐,人手一机的场景早已司空见惯。作为连接虚拟与现实世界的桥梁,移动应用的开发可谓如火如荼。
对于开发者而言,高效智能的开发工具是保证工作效率的关键所在。在这股"工具革命"的浪潮中,Visual Studio Code(VS Code绝对是当之无愛的佼佼者。
作为一款轻量级但功能强大的代码编辑器,VS Code凭借开源、跨平台等优势,迅速获得了开发者的青睐。无论是Web前端、后端服务,还是移动应用开发,VS Code都可以为开发者提供高效、智能、个性化的编码体验。
而对于移动开发者来说,VS Code更是神助攻的存在。通过安装各种扩展和插件,VS Code可以完美支持主流的移动开发框架,如React Native、Flutter、Ionic等。开发者可以在熟悉的编辑环境中,借助强大的工具链,高效编写、调试和部署移动应用。
这一切的背后,离不开VS Code移动端开发的6大神器工具的加持。这6款插件涵盖了从编码、调试到UI设计等各个环节,堪称移动开发的"瑞士军刀"。它们不仅能极大提升开发效率,更能为开发者带来前所未有的智能化体验。
VS Code移动端开发的6大神器工具到底有哪些呢?让我们一一拨开迷雾,看看它们分别都有哪些"绝活"。
第一大神器,就是React Native Tools。作为React Native官方推荐的扩展,它为开发者提供了代码自动补全、内联参数提示、代码导航等功能,极大提高了开发效率。更令人惊喜的是,它还支持直接在编辑器中预览React Native组件的渲染效果,摆脱了传统的编码-编译-运行的繁琐流程。
第二大神器是Flutter扩展包。Flutter无疑是谷歌力推的新一代移动开发框架,而这款扩展则让VS Code成为了Flutter开发的绝佳选择。它提供了代码高亮、代码补全、代码重构等常规功能,同时还支持热重载、调试等高级功能,让开发者能够实时查看修改效果。
第三大神器是Debugger for Mobile,一款出色的移动应用调试工具。通过这款扩展,开发者可以直接在VS Code中进行断点调试、变量监视等操作,无需再频繁切换到模拟器或真机。它支持iOS、Android、React Native等多种平台,是移动开发者的必备神器。
第四大神器是Preview on Web Server。顾名思义,它可以让开发者在浏览器中实时预览移动应用的UI效果,而无需频繁编译和部署到设备上。这不仅提高了开发效率,也避免了反复操作带来的设备耗电和发热问题。
第五大神器是适用于Ionic框架的Ionic扩展包。Ionic是一个流行的混合式应用开发框架,而这款扩展则让VS Code成为了Ionic开发的利器。它提供了智能代码补全、代码片段、调试支持等功能,极大提升了Ionic开发的效率和体验。
最后一个神器,就是App扩展包了。虽然名字有些"泛泛",但它凝聚了VS Code移动开发的多种精华。比如,它支持在编辑器中实时预览iOS和Android应用的UI效果;它还能一键运行和调试应用,免去了繁琐的命令行操作;更有代码检查、自动修复等智能化功能,让编码质量得到有力保证。
有了这6大神器的加持,VS Code彻底成为了移动开发者的"瑞士军刀"。无论你是React Native、Flutter还是Ionic的拥趸,都可以在熟悉的编码环境中,享受高效、智能、个性化的开发体验。
而这,仅仅是个开端。VS Code将继深耕移动开发领域,不断推出更多智能化工具和扩展,帮助开发者遇见更高效、更智慧的编程体验。相信在不久的将来,VS Code定将成为移动开发者的"标配"利器,引领移动应用开发进入全新的智能化时代。
掌握这6大神器工具,就等于获得了移动应用开发的"终极密钥"。它们不仅能极大提升开发效率,更能为开发者带来前所未有的智能化体验,让编码变得更加高效、智慧、有趣。移动开发者们,还等什么呢?快拥抱VS Code和它的6大神器吧,开启你的高效编程之旅!